Apple has released a US app that encouraged users to gather in secret clandestine meetings during the coronavirus pandemic.
The Vybe Together app, which promoted private parties, has been removed from Apple’s App Store, banned from its TikTok account, and rubbed most of its online presence, and creators of the app have told The Virgin that Apple has banned it.
Vybe Together was introduced to TikTok and its website as a place to organize and attend illegal parties in violation of social distancing laws, using the slogan “Get your rebel on. Start your party.”
“The young lady playing beer pong, flirting with strangers and generally just having fun with the crew? Vybe is here for you, ”the website said.
